Resolving Ethernet Cable Problems

A usual problem many people face is a faulty ethernet cable. This can hinder your device from connecting to the web. To resolve this issue, follow these steps:

* First, inspect the plugs of the cable for any wear.

* Then, try a alternative ethernet cable.

* If the problem persists, verify your network card by connecting to a other device.

Connect DP to HDMI Adapter for Monitor Compatibility

Before you plug your DisplayPort gadget into an HDMI port, make sure you have the right adapter. Many monitors don't support DisplayPort directly, so you'll need a DP to HDMI adapter for compatibility. Some adapters offer audio transfer as well, which is handy if your source device has both video and audio outputs. Always consult the specifications of your monitor and adapter to ensure they are compatible.

Examining Your Ethernet Cable for Connectivity Issues

Experiencing frustrating network interruptions? A faulty Ethernet cable could be the culprit. Before you upgrade your entire network setup, it's worth checking your cable for any connectivity issues. Start by thoroughly reviewing the cable for any visible defects, such as bent pins, broken shielding, or frayed ends. A damaged cable can disrupt the signal transmission, leading to intermittent connections.

Additionally, you can use a network tool to verify the cable's computer power cable integrity. This instrument sends signals through the cable and evaluates the signal strength and response time. If the results indicate weak signal strength or high latency, it's a strong indication that your Ethernet cable needs to be substituted.
